91av视频/亚洲h视频/操亚洲美女/外国一级黄色毛片 - 国产三级三级三级三级

  • 大小: 7KB
    文件類型: .rar
    金幣: 2
    下載: 0 次
    發布日期: 2021-06-02
  • 語言: C/C++
  • 標簽: c++??實現??

資源簡介

馬爾科夫鏈的C++代碼實現 并且有測試文本

資源截圖

代碼片段和文件信息

#include“markov.h“
#include
#include
#include
#include
#include
#include


using?namespace?std;

map?>?statetab;

void?build(Prefix&?pifstream&?in)
{
string?buf;
while?(in?>>?buf)
add(pbuf);
}

void?add(Prefix&?p?const?string&?s)
{
if??(p.size()?==?NPREF?)
{
statetab[p].push_back(s);
p.pop_front();
}
p.push_back(s);
}

void?generate(int?nwords)
{
Prefix?p;
for?(int?i=0;i add(pNONWORD);
ofstream?output;
output.open(“outfile.txt“);
for?(int?j=0;j {
vector&?suf?=?statetab[p];
const?string&?w=suf[rand()?%?suf.size()];
if??(w==NONWORD)
break;
output< p.pop_front();
p.push_back(w);
}
}

?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----

?????文件????????796??2009-09-10?15:20??Markov_luocheng\m1.cpp

?????文件????????270??2009-09-10?15:25??Markov_luocheng\m2.cpp

?????文件????????136??2009-09-10?15:26??Markov_luocheng\makefile

?????文件????????419??2009-09-10?15:25??Markov_luocheng\markov.h

?????文件??????13359??2009-09-09?23:37??Markov_luocheng\Obama.txt

?????目錄??????????0??2009-09-10?15:28??Markov_luocheng

-----------?---------??----------?-----??----

????????????????14980????????????????????6


評論

共有 條評論